Well hello everyone i was just looking at my infusium 23 (original formula) leave in conditioner and my african pride braid sheen spary. At the moment my hair is in individual braids and im trying to give my hair as much moisture as possible. So far i like the infusium becuase it truly does stop breakage and the braid spray just spoils my hair. Just a few minutes ago (after reading some threads on hear) i decided that im going to spray my hair on a daily basis, and use the infusium on a daily basis also. To make things less harder on myself i just decided to put the infusium into and old spray container. I also decided to start spraying my hair at night with the infusium23 then in the morning spray it with the braid sheen, or spary it with the infusium and the braid sheen....do y'all think this is a good idea?!, if not do u have anymore moisture tips... /images/graemlins/drunk.gif

Hi elite chiq,
I'm currently following the hair braiding regime constructed by Robin Woods www.growafrohairlong. I use infusium 23 orignal on a daily basis, along with African Pride braid sheen spray. i only apply these products, lightly on the braids and use them once a week on the scalp after shampooing.

My hair type is 4a/4b hair, these products still helps maintain the correct moisture levels in my hair. In my opinion it is best not to use excess amounts of product, it will only leave your hair greasy and may also make it harder to take out your braids. USE THEM SPARINGLY!

If you're hair is not receiving enough moisture I'll suggest trying sta-sof-fro sheen spray(I have used this myself). It contains Glycerin; this extracts moisture from the air and locks in moisture to the hair shaft, it also contains proteins to keep hair strong.
